< návrat zpět

MS Excel


Téma: Makro pro všechny listy rss

Zaslal/a 14.4.2019 17:43

LugrDobrý den,

lze provést toto makro na všech listech?
Nějak si s tím nevím rady.

Sub skryt()


Dim wsSheet As Worksheet
Set wsSheet = Worksheets("List1")


If wsSheet.Columns("C:C").EntireColumn.Hidden = False Then

wsSheet.Columns("C:C").EntireColumn.Hidden = True
wsSheet.Columns("AI:AI").EntireColumn.Hidden = True
wsSheet.Rows("77").EntireRow.Hidden = True
wsSheet.Rows("80").EntireRow.Hidden = True

Else

wsSheet.Columns("C:C").EntireColumn.Hidden = False
wsSheet.Columns("AI:AI").EntireColumn.Hidden = False
wsSheet.Rows("77").EntireRow.Hidden = False
wsSheet.Rows("80").EntireRow.Hidden = False

End If

End Sub

Zaslat odpověď >

#043153
elninoslov
Vložiť do modulu
Sub Skryt()
Dim wsSheet As Worksheet, bSkyt As Boolean

For Each wsSheet In ThisWorkbook.Worksheets
With wsSheet
bSkyt = .Columns("C:C").EntireColumn.Hidden = False
.Range("C1,AI1").EntireColumn.Hidden = bSkyt
.Range("A77,A80").EntireRow.Hidden = bSkyt
End With
Next wsSheet
End Sub
citovat

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

On-line nástroje

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Aktivní diskuse

Čas od do

jarek1111 • 18.4. 8:32

Čas od do

jarek1111 • 18.4. 8:31

Makro smyčka

MilanKop • 18.4. 7:18

Makro smyčka

elninoslov • 18.4. 0:18

Makro smyčka

MilanKop • 17.4. 21:33

Automatické generování souborů

Majki • 17.4. 13:48

Automatické generování souborů

elninoslov • 17.4. 13:27